what is md5 technology No Further a Mystery
what is md5 technology No Further a Mystery
Blog Article
These are just one-way features – Which suggests that it is unfeasible to use the hash benefit to determine what the initial input was (with current technology and procedures).
The reason for This can be this modulo Procedure can only give us ten individual effects, and with 10 random quantities, there's nothing halting many of those outcomes from getting precisely the same range.
No, md5 is no more deemed protected for password storage. It's several vulnerabilities, for example collision assaults and rainbow table assaults.
Afterwards while in the decade, a number of cryptographers commenced ironing out The fundamental specifics of cryptographic functions. Michael Rabin put forward a structure based upon the DES block cipher.
It was printed in the public domain a yr later on. Merely a 12 months afterwards a “pseudo-collision” with the MD5 compression operate was uncovered. The timeline of MD5 learned (and exploited) vulnerabilities is as follows:
A hash collision happens when two diverse inputs make a similar hash benefit, or output. The safety and encryption of the hash algorithm depend on generating distinctive hash values, and collisions signify safety vulnerabilities that may be exploited.
While it has identified protection issues, MD5 continues to be employed for password hashing in software. MD5 is accustomed to retail outlet passwords with a a single-way hash with the password, but it is not website One of the encouraged hashes for this purpose. MD5 is frequent and user friendly, and builders normally nonetheless decide on it for password hashing and storage.
MD5, or Message Digest Algorithm 5, is ubiquitous on the planet of cybersecurity and Personal computer antivirus packages. Recognized for its position in generating hash values, MD5 can be a part in procedures that hold our digital information and info Protected.
Insecure hash capabilities Preferably render this action computationally not possible. However, MD5’s flaws authorized these attacks with much less do the job than expected.
If everything inside the file has altered, the checksum will not match, as well as receiver’s product will know the file is corrupted.
Greg is actually a technologist and facts geek with over 10 years in tech. He has worked in a number of industries being an IT manager and computer software tester. Greg is undoubtedly an avid author on everything IT associated, from cyber protection to troubleshooting. Additional from the author
Blake2. Blake2 is usually a high-speed cryptographic hash perform that provides safety akin to SHA-three but is quicker plus much more economical concerning performance. It's ideal for the two cryptographic and non-cryptographic programs.
Right before diving into MD5 specifically, let's briefly touch upon the notion of hashing on the whole. In uncomplicated conditions, hashing is usually a system that takes an input (also referred to as the message or info) and generates a set-measurement string of figures as output, which can be called the hash code or hash worth.
The MD5 hash perform’s protection is considered to be severely compromised. Collisions can be found within just seconds, and they may be used for malicious uses. In actual fact, in 2012, the Flame spyware that infiltrated A huge number of pcs and equipment in Iran was considered one of many most troublesome protection problems with the calendar year.